Maximizing ROI with PPC: Strategies for Successful Campaigns
Pay-Per-Click (PPC) advertising stands as one of the most measurable and controllable marketing channels. When wielded with precision, it can be a significant driver of traffic and conversions, offering a clear path to return on investment (ROI). However, PPC is not a set-it-and-forget-it solution; it requires a strategic approach to maximize ROI. Understanding PPC
ROI in PPC is the ratio of net profit to cost of investment in your pay-per-click campaigns. To maximize ROI, you need to increase the profit generated from your ads relative to the cost. 1. Keyword Research: The Foundation
Start with comprehensive keyword research. Use tools like Google’s Keyword Planner to find high-intent keywords that are relevant to your offerings but not so competitive that you’re outbid by larger players.
2. Compelling Ad Copy: The Hook
Your ad copy should be the hook that grabs attention. Highlight your unique selling propositions and include a strong call-to-action. Tailoring messages to the search intent can dramatically improve click-through rates.
3. Landing Page Alignment: The Converting Machine
Ensure your landing pages are directly aligned with your ad copy to provide a cohesive user experience. Landing pages should load quickly, display clear calls-to-action, and minimize friction in the conversion process.
4. Bid Management: The Balancing Act
Effective bid management is crucial. Regularly adjust bids based on the performance of keywords, times of day, and locations. Utilize bid modifiers and consider automated bidding strategies to optimize for conversions.
5. Quality Score: The Silent ROI Booster
A high Quality Score can lower your cost per click and cost per conversion. Improve your score by optimizing ad relevance, expected click-through rate, and landing page experience.
6. Targeting: The Precision Approach
Define your audience with precision. Use demographic data, user behavior, and interests to target or exclude segments, ensuring your ads reach those most likely to convert.
7. Testing and Optimization: The Path to Perfection
Continuously test different elements of your campaigns, including ad copy, keywords, and landing pages. Employ A/B testing to find the winning formulas and implement them across the board.
8. Use of Ad Extensions: The Information Enhancers
Ad extensions provide additional information and increase the size of your ads. Use sitelink, call, location, and other extensions to improve visibility and provide more paths to conversion.
9. Analytics: The Measuring Tape
Rigorously analyze your PPC campaign data. Look beyond clicks and impressions; focus on conversion rates, cost per conversion, and profit per click. This data informs strategic decisions and optimization efforts.
10. Adaptation: The Agile Mindset
Stay agile and be ready to adapt your strategies based on market changes, competitor actions, and performance data. PPC is a dynamic field; staying on top of trends and adjusting accordingly is key to maintaining a high ROI.
